Abstract

Although there were a lot of studies published concerning the Palestinian cause during the Mandate and Occupation of Britain, these studies were neglected and overlooked in the history of Arab journalism in Palestine. As a result, its role of defending the Arabism and independence of Palestine was made absent. It seems that the reason for this negligence referred to the circumstances that happened in 1948 by the destruction and loss of most of the Arabic journal issues published concerning it. It was possible if it were to add a lot to the Palestinian history.
